The cheapest way to get from Calabasas to Victorville is to bus which costs $17 - $28 and takes 5h 4m.
The fastest way to get from Calabasas to Victorville is to drive which takes 1h 47m and costs $19 - $28.
No, there is no direct bus from Calabasas to Victorville. However, there are services departing from Park Granada & Calabasas Rd and arriving at Victorville Transit Center via Olympic / Flower and Los Angeles Downtown.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 4m.
No, there is no direct train from Calabasas to Victorville. However, there are services departing from Chatsworth and arriving at Victorville Amtrak via Los Angeles.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 22m.
The distance between Calabasas and Victorville is 117 miles. The road distance is 104.7 miles.
The best way to get from Calabasas to Victorville without a car is to bus which takes 5h 4m and costs $17 - $28.
It takes approximately 5h 4m to get from Calabasas to Victorville, including transfers.
Calabasas to Victorville bus services, operated by LA DOT, depart from Park Granada & Calabasas Rd station.
Calabasas to Victorville train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Chatsworth station.
The best way to get from Calabasas to Victorville is to bus which takes 5h 4m and costs $17 - $28.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$45 - $100 and takes 6h 22m.
